Gene variant protects against inherited form of dementia

A brand new examine means that people who find themselves in danger for uncommon genetic types of frontotemporal dementia ought to contemplate being examined for a typical gene variant that may shield them in opposition to the group of problems.

A number one explanation for dementia, frontotemporal dementia sometimes develops in midlife and might be attributable to uncommon genetic mutations or happen sporadically of their absence.

“We all know that uncommon mutations in primarily three genes may cause genetic frontotemporal dementia, however together with this frequent protecting TMEM106B variant, the illness might by no means begin, it could come on later or be extra delicate,” says Mario Masellis, principal investigator of the Canadian arm of the worldwide Genetic Frontotemporal Dementia Initiative, neurologist at Sunnybrook Well being Sciences Centre and a neurology professor within the College of Toronto’s Temerty College of Drugs.

“You will need to think about this protecting variant when a person is concerned in a medical trial or when somebody is contemplating discovering out their genetic mutation standing for frontotemporal dementia. That is significantly necessary if they arrive from a household with a recognized genetic trigger, for the reason that presence of two copies of this protecting variant will alter danger and might modify outcomes of analysis investigations.”

Printed within the journal Mind, the researchers advocate accounting for the protecting variant in medical trials that focus on the neurocognitive dysfunction as a result of it may possibly have an effect on measures assessed in these research, similar to mind shrinkage or atrophy, neurodegeneration biomarkers in blood exams and different measurements and cognitive abilities.

The protecting variant was found in earlier large-scale genome-wide research that confirmed it was protecting in opposition to a selected subtype of the illness related to a novel irregular protein signature within the mind known as TDP. The protecting impact was even stronger in people with mutations within the GRN gene.

Nonetheless, researchers by no means absolutely understood how the variant protected in opposition to illness. In the newest examine, investigators examined the genetic variant in 518 individuals with, or susceptible to growing, genetic frontotemporal dementia.

“Our examine reveals that people with two copies of this protecting variant—one from every father or mother, and likewise to a lesser diploma in these with one copy—had much less mind shrinkage, much less neurodegeneration and fewer decline in cognition, particularly in the event that they carried a GRN mutation,” says Masellis, who can be a scientist within the Hurvitz Mind Sciences Analysis Program at Sunnybrook Analysis Institute.

The examine was co-led by Saira Mirza, analysis affiliate on the Dr. Sandra Black Centre for Mind Resilience and Restoration at Sunnybrook, and Maurice Pasternak, a Ph.D. candidate in Temerty Drugs’s Institute of Medical Sciences.

Roughly one-third of individuals with frontotemporal dementia inherit it from their mother and father. And whereas the genetically inherited kinds are uncommon, they trigger an earlier onset of dementia and profound adjustments in habits and language talents that considerably affect people and their households within the prime of their lives.

Moreover, there are presently no authorized disease-modifying therapies for genetic frontotemporal dementia, though a number of drug candidates are being evaluated in medical trials.

“Data of the pure development of each genetic and sporadic frontotemporal dementia, and the identification of things that modify its course are essential for the efficient improvement of novel therapeutics, ideally throughout the levels between the looks of preliminary signs and their full improvement and even earlier, earlier than irrecoverable mind harm has occurred,” the authors write within the examine.

“This frequent protecting variant needs to be accounted for as it may possibly and can skew analysis outcomes, resulting in both false-positive or false-negative findings in medical trials. This work is guiding us to precision drugs in motion as therapeutic methods might come up from exploiting protecting genetic mechanisms.”
